If you’re making a presentation in an online meeting, you’ll probably need to share your screen so the audience can see your slides.
Although you can choose to share your entire desktop, Microsoft Teams also lets you pick a specific app to share, so participants see only the presentation, which can be from any app, such as Keynote or PowerPoint.
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to share your screen via video call and chat from the desktop app.

How to share your screen during Microsoft Teams call (Windows / macOS)
It is possible to share your screen with one or more people on a Teams call.
1. Join a meeting, then click the screen sharing icon that appears at the bottom of the window.
2. Select a screen under Desktop or a specific Window you’d like to share. The windows shown will include all the apps you have open, and you’ll be able to choose to share a second monitor if you have more than one connected.
The screen will automatically start sharing for others on the call.
3. Finally, click ‘stop sharing’ in the bottom tab on the call.
How to share your screen on Microsoft Teams (iOS / Android)
We’re using an iPhone here, but the steps are the same on Android.
1. In the call, tap the three dots that appear at the bottom of your screen, then tap ‘Share’.
2. Next, tap ‘Share screen’. Your device might ask you to allow Teams to record the screen, so grant this permission.
3. Click ‘start broadcast.’
4. Viewers will see the Teams app until you switch to the app you want to share with them.
4. When finished, return to the Teams app and tap ‘Stop Broadcast’ to stop sharing your screen.
How to share your screen on Microsoft Teams Chat
In some cases you might want to share your screen with someone while using Teams’ chat function.
This is available in the macOS and Windows app. On mobile, you’ll have to first start a video call before you can select the Share option, as detailed above.
1. Click the screen sharing icon in the top right corner of the chat message.
2. Next, select ‘Screen 1’ or one of the apps listed under ‘Window’ depending on what part of your screen you’d like to share.
Options of the different windows you have open, such as browser, PowerPoint etc.
3. Once selected, screen sharing will begin automatically.
4. Finally, click ‘stop presenting’ in the top bar to stop sharing your screen.
